Nickel targets are available in a variety of forms, purities, sizes and prices. Nickel sputtering target is composed of high purity nickel metal. Nickel is a hard, shiny, silvery-white metal. It has a density of 8.91 g/cc, a melting point of 1,453 °C, and a vapor pressure of 237 Pa (1726K). Its main characteristics are ductility, malleability and ferromagnetism, and its polished surface does not lose its luster when exposed to air.

Nickel target material production method
The nickel plate is polished, the polished nickel plate is centrifugally ground, and the nickel target is produced. Because metal nickel has good mechanical strength, withstand external force, resistance to deformation and fracture ability is strong, so it is suitable for polishing, grinding and other processing methods. The oxides and impurities on the surface of the nickel plate can be effectively removed by polishing, and then the impurities on the surface of the nickel plate can be further removed by centrifugal grinding, and the cleanliness of the nickel target can be effectively improved by polishing combined with centrifugal grinding.
Nickel target application
Nickel sputtering targets are used for thin film deposition, decoration, semiconductors, displays, LED and photovoltaic devices, functional coatings, and other optical information storage space industries, glass coating industries such as automotive glass and architectural glass, optical communication and other industries, have good application prospects.
Other applications for nickel include the manufacture of stainless steel, coins and batteries. When evaporated in a vacuum, nickel can form a decorative coating on ceramic surfaces or a welding layer in circuit device manufacturing. In the production of magnetic storage media, fuel cells and sensors, it is often sputtered as cambium.
